Étienne Fermigier was the king of curves and undulations. He experimented, like pioneer Pierre Paulin before him, with new foam technology and metal construction to achieve new forms that were sinuous and organic. Fermigier was a self-starter, opening his own design practice the year he graduated in 1957, but his promising career was cut short in a car accident in 1973. This wavy chair, attributed to him, has an ergonomic and enveloping seat.
